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Unable to handle IllegalStateException: ABORTED #12293

Open
andyfieldberg opened this issue Sep 20, 2024 · 1 comment
Open

Unable to handle IllegalStateException: ABORTED #12293

andyfieldberg opened this issue Sep 20, 2024 · 1 comment
Labels
Bug For general bugs on Jetty side

Comments

@andyfieldberg
Copy link

andyfieldberg commented Sep 20, 2024

Jetty version(s)

11.0.20

Jetty Environment

Spring Boot

Java version/vendor (use: java -version)

Kotlin, Java 21

OS type/version

Linux ??

Description

  error 2024.08.14 07:34:57.874 eu-fra1 applepay-0000000-w00wb - - 5ddfdda418c5d000002c2ed9467b8f 2024-36121-g665353e1d2e0c4 488 ApplePayEndpoin service 89.113.152.11 Unable to handle /v1/orders/order.com.applepay.tracking.v2/38841051-61671 java.lang.IllegalStateException: ABORTED
	at org.eclipse.jetty.server.HttpChannelState.sendError(HttpChannelState.java:911)
	at org.eclipse.jetty.server.Response.sendError(Response.java:501)
	at org.eclipse.jetty.server.Response.sendError(Response.java:468)
	at com.ecwid.applepay.app.endpoints.core.RestApi.writeResponse(RestApi.kt:75)
	at com.ecwid.applepay.app.endpoints.core.RestApi.service(RestApi.kt:36)
	at com.ecwid.applepay.app.endpoints.applepay.ApplePayEndpointsServlet.service(ApplePayEndpointsServlet.kt:40)
	at jakarta.servlet.http.HttpServlet.service(HttpServlet.java:614)
	at com.ecwid.skeleton.feature.http.wrappers.BaseServletWrapper.service(BaseServletWrapper.kt:16)
	at com.ecwid.skeleton.feature.http.wrappers.encoding.EncodingServletWrapper.service(EncodingServletWrapper.kt:23)
	at com.ecwid.skeleton.feature.http.wrappers.httpinfo.HttpContextServletWrapper.service(HttpContextServletWrapper.kt:32)
	at com.ecwid.skeleton.feature.http.wrappers.metrics.InstrumentedServletWrapper.traceRequest(InstrumentedServletWrapper.kt:54)
	at com.ecwid.skeleton.feature.http.wrappers.metrics.InstrumentedServletWrapper.service(InstrumentedServletWrapper.kt:28)
	at com.ecwid.skeleton.feature.http.wrappers.request.RequestHeadersServletWrapper.service(RequestHeadersServletWrapper.kt:21)
	at com.ecwid.skeleton.feature.http.wrappers.exception.ExceptionHandlerWrapper.service(ExceptionHandlerWrapper.kt:34)
	at jakarta.servlet.http.HttpServlet.service(HttpServlet.java:614)
	   ...skip 11 items...
	at com.ecwid.skeleton.feature.http.jetty.NoTraceServer.handle(NoTraceServer.kt:26)
	   ...skip 19 items...
	at java.base/java.lang.Thread.run(Thread.java:1583)

How to reproduce?

@andyfieldberg andyfieldberg added the Bug For general bugs on Jetty side label Sep 20, 2024
@sbordet
Copy link
Contributor

sbordet commented Sep 20, 2024

Jetty 11 is at end of community support, see #10485.

Please upgrade to Jetty 12 and report back if you still have the issue.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Bug For general bugs on Jetty side
Projects
None yet
Development

No branches or pull requests

2 participants